Why did blacks begin to expect more civil rights after World War II?

Respuesta :

HistoryGuy HistoryGuy
  • 23-04-2015
WWII represented somewhat of a turning point for race relations in the United States because it became visibly absurd that blacks could be asked to fight and be killed for a country that did not treat them fairly.
